Steve Sutton is an Accredited Mental Health Social Worker (AMHSW) with 14 years of experience integrating psychotherapy and practical support to help individuals and families through complex challenges.
Steve takes a holistic, systems-informed view of mental health — recognising that housing, finances, relationships, work and community connection all profoundly affect wellbeing. He helps clients address both the emotional and practical dimensions of their difficulties.
His therapeutic approach draws on CBT, DBT-informed skills, Narrative Therapy and community-based advocacy, with a strong commitment to social justice and equitable access to care.
Steve works with adults, families and individuals experiencing depression, anxiety, trauma, housing stress, domestic violence and complex social situations. He is a Medicare-registered AMHSW and accepts Mental Health Care Plan referrals.
